Re-created the sub bass and sub movement and fixed the mix down. Whats it sounding like on your end? Thanks for the responses, it helps having a fresh pair of ears I've got a bit close to the tune you know? Soundcloud
This is sounding 10x better.
Decent bass presence, good reece sound.
The reece can of course still use more movement but now that you've got the basics down it will be easier to manipulate.
Do some notch modulation and find the sweet spots to tweak the reece.
You could also pick spots where you stab the reece rather than having it play through out.
Add an machine gun reece as well at times while you at it to change the feel for a few secs and then back.
